HSEC Lux is the second sub-fund of HarbourVest Global Private Solution SICAV S.A., a Luxembourg Part II SICAV supervised by the CSSF and anchored since 2023 by the Swedish pension fund AP7. Announced on 3 November 2025 as the HarbourVest Evergreen Secondaries Solution, it buys LP-led fund interests and GP-led continuation deals, sourced through HarbourVest's relationships with more than 600 general partners, and was seeded by a cornerstone investor so that it launched already diversified. It is not an ELTIF.

| Structure | Luxembourg Part II SICAV sub-fund (RCS B272336); AIFM HarbourVest Partners (Ireland) Limited; portfolio manager HarbourVest Partners L.P.; depositary BNY Mellon Luxembourg; SFDR Article 6 |
| Strategy | Global private equity secondaries: LP-led portfolio purchases, GP-led continuation vehicles, structured liquidity and team spin-outs, plus selected primaries; buyout core, borrowing up to 30% of NAV |
| Deal flow | Shared with the Dover Street flagship funds, which are entitled to at least 70% of each secondary opportunity |
| Subscriptions | Monthly; dealing deadline five business days before the valuation date; NAV published around the 20th business day of the following month |
| Redemptions | Quarterly with 20 business days' notice; settled within ten business days of NAV publication; capped at 5% of NAV per quarter |
| Early redemption | 5% fee on shares held under 12 months; Class IX-1 locked for three years; seed Class S locked for five |
| Distribution | Registered in LU, BE, DK, FI, FR, DE (professional/semi-professional), IT, LI, MC, NO, ES, SE, CH, NL and the UK; not for US persons |
| ISIN | LU3184405572 (A-1 EUR); LU3184405812 (A-1 USD); LU3184406034 (AX-1 EUR) |

Points to weigh: the KID's all-in cost of 7.7–8.6% a year is high compared with closed-end secondaries funds; the incentive payment carries no hurdle and no clawback; liquidity is gated at 5% of NAV per quarter and can be suspended; and the fund has operated only since November 2025 with no published NAV, fund size or performance record yet.
